    Drake Reveals Amsterdam’s Secret: “Without This City, There’d Be No Adonis”

    WamalaBy WamalaAugust 3, 2025No Comments2 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est WhatsApp Email

    Drake brought more than just chart-topping hits to his sold-out Ziggo Dome show this week — the rapper gave fans a rare, touching glimpse into his personal life.

    As reported by TMZ on July 31, during the first of his three Amsterdam performances, the Grammy winner revealed a deep connection to the city that goes beyond the stage: Amsterdam is where his son, Adonis, was conceived.

    “Without Amsterdam, There Would Be No Adonis”

    With a playful smile and a crowd full of cheers and laughter, Drake told fans,

    “Without Amsterdam, there would be no Adonis.”

    This simple yet powerful line quickly became the night’s highlight — transforming a casual shoutout into a sentimental tribute that resonated deeply.

    The Story Behind the Bond

    Drake and French artist Sophie Brussaux were first spotted together in Amsterdam in January 2017. Just months later, their son Adonis was born in October, mere days before Drake’s 31st birthday.

    Unlike many celebrity co-parenting stories fraught with drama, Drake and Sophie have maintained a quiet, cooperative relationship, often showing up together for family events while keeping their private lives mostly out of the spotlight.

    drake reveals adonis was conceived in amsterdam 😂💙 pic.twitter.com/PPBXlwvBs5

    — D ♱ (@_diana_salam) July 30, 2025

    Adonis Stepping Into His Own Spotlight

    Adonis isn’t just Drake’s son — he’s carving out his own creative path. In 2023, he designed the cover art for Drake’s album For All the Dogs, highlighting their growing father-son bond and signaling Adonis’s emerging artistry.

    Drake’s recent Amsterdam remarks reminded fans that beyond music and fame, the connection with Adonis is a central part of his life’s narrative — a story of fatherhood, mentorship, and love.

    A Moment Fans Won’t Forget

    Drake’s Amsterdam show was filled with hits spanning his decades-long career, but it was this unexpected, heartfelt confession that had fans buzzing. The Ziggo Dome crowd witnessed a rare glimpse into the man behind the music — one who openly honors the city tied to his family’s roots.

    What’s Next for Drake?

    This Amsterdam performance kicks off the next leg of Drake’s extensive European tour, where more hits and personal moments await.
